River regulation and design of flood protection
Gřegoř, Adam ; Julínek, Tomáš (referee) ; Duchan, David (advisor)
The bachelor’s thesis deals with designing flood protection on the watercourse Velička (tributary of the river Bečva), which is situated in the area of Hranice municipality. The flow modelling was done as 1D surface water HEC-RAS model. Two options of flood protection were designed based on the size of the flood areas that occured during flood flows Q5, Q20 and Q100. The first option did not consider the usage of Lhotka dry pond. The second option considered the usage of Lhotka dry pond, which was designed in the study made by AgPOL s.r.o. firm to the north of Hranice and which transforms flood flows. The result of the bachelor’s thesis are maps of flood areas that occured during the flood flows Q5, Q20 and Q100 after the implementation of flood protection options. In conclusion, the suitability of the flood protection options is evaluated.
Research of the influence of a new method for ball-attach process on BGA packages on intermetallic layers
Gregor, Adam ; Jankovský, Jaroslav (referee) ; Otáhal, Alexandr (advisor)
This work deals with exploring a new method of ball-attach process on BGA packages using a directly heated stencil. The existing procedures of making solder bumps were compared with possible benefits of using this new method. The methodology was established to create samples using a new reflow method and its effect on the formation and strength of intermetallic layers of solder bumps, due to the set height of the heated template, which was designed for reflow of BGA terminals. In addition to the design of the methodology, shear tests and metallographic sections of the samples were also performed. The thickness of the intermetallic layer and its roughness were examined. An evaluation of the results was performed on the basis of which a new method of reflow soldering of solder balls on BGA packages was optimized.
Room Impulse Response Estimation from Speech Signal
Gregor, Adam ; Szőke, Igor (referee) ; Černocký, Jan (advisor)
Jakýkoliv zvuk šířící se místností je zkreslen impulsní odezvou této místnosti. Měření těchto impulsních odezev bylo vždy důležitou úlohou akustiky, která v dnešní době ještě nabyla na důležitosti, díky možnosti požití impulsních odezev při augmentaci dat pro účely trénování automatických rozpoznávačů řeči. Standardně je impulsní odezva místnosti měřena za pomoci čisté a zkreslené formy zvukového signálu. To je však v praxi nepraktické (například u domácích asistentů či chytrých domů), neboť zde je k dispozici jen zkreslený signál. Tato bakalářská práce se zabývá odhadem impulsní odezvy "naslepo, pouze pomocí zkresleného řečového signálu. Nejdříve jsme za použití datasetu BUT ReverbDB re-implementovali standardní techniky pro měření impulsní odezvy z čistého/zkresleného signálu. Poté jsme testovali dvě techniky odhadující impulsní odezvu místnosti pouze ze zkreslené řeči.  První technika k tomu používá impulsní fonémy ve zkreslené řeči, u kterých se předpokládá, že se podobají impulsním odezvám místností. Bylo testováno průměrování a dekonvoluce těchto fonémů za účelem zvýšení kvality a robustnosti odhadu. Druhá technika využívá regresní neuronové sítě generující impulsní odezvy místností z řeči na vstupu. Ačkoliv žádná z navrhovaných technik nedosahuje odhadů na úrovni standardních měření, mají tyto odhady potenciál při augmentaci dat pro trénování automatických rozpoznávačů řeči.
Research of reliability of solder ball terminals on BGA packages attached by innovative method
Gregor, Adam ; Jankovský, Jaroslav (referee) ; Otáhal, Alexandr (advisor)
This master´s thesis deals with the investigation of the reliability and service life of solder bumps on BGA packages created using new method using directly heated stencil. The methodology of reliability tests using isothermal and cyclic thermal aging of solder ball terminals was proposed. Test samples of BGA packages were created using this new method of reflow solder bumps and then was statistically evaluated. The internal structure and crystallographic orientation of the planes were investigated.
Hydraulic analysis of the Bečva river
Gřegoř, Adam ; Smelík, Lukáš (referee) ; Duchan, David (advisor)
The subject of this diploma thesis is a comparison between two river hydraulics modeling approaches, the first one being combined 1D and 2D modeling, and the second one being solely 2D modeling. Both models are located at Bečva river, between its 17,282 and 28,419 river kilometer. The outputs of the simulations are water flow velocity maps, water depth maps, maps that show differences between flood areas calculated in both models, tables comparing channel water surface elevations and schematic long sections. In conclusion of the thesis, the outputs of the simulations are compared.
Vehicle Make and Model Recognition
Gregor, Adam ; Špaňhel, Jakub (referee) ; Juránek, Roman (advisor)
V praktické části diplomové práce byla realizována úloha ozpoznání výrobce a modelu vozidla (VMMR). V první části byla pro účely strojového učení sestavena datová sada vozidel sestávající se z obrázků z Internetu. Takto bylo získáno přes 6 milionů obrázků aut, autobusů, motorek a dodávek, použitelných pro úlohu VMMR. Dále byla v rámci ex- perimentů na část datové sady použita standardní klasifikace, kdy na enkodér navazuje klasifikační vrstva realizovaná použitím neuronové sítě, a přístup, kdy za pomocí metody supervised contrastive learning byly embeddingy z enkodérů shlukovány za účelem snazší klasifikace. Jelikož první uvedený přístup vracel přesnější výsledky, byl použit v dalších experimentech. V nich se použilo větší množství obrázků z naší datové sady k natrénování klasifikátoru pro VMMR. Další klasifikátory byly natrénovány na datových sadách Stan- ford Cars a Comprehensive cars. Posléze bylo při porovnávání funkčnosti klasifikátorů na různých datových sadách shledáno, že klasifikátor trénovaný na naší datové sadě si vedl nejlépe.
Revitalisation of the Chrudimka river
Rychlý, Patrik ; Gřegoř, Adam (referee) ; Duchan, David (advisor)
The diploma thesis deals with the hydraulic verification of the design of the millrace revitalization in the Chrudim town intravillage from the bachelor's thesis Úprava toku na vybrané lokalitě from 2021. The thesis describes the current flow state and the location of interest, the method of building a 2D hydraulic model, a description of changes in the proposed modification, and then a description of the hydraulic verification of the design. As a result of the thesis, the maps of a spill, depths, and velocities for flood flow Q5, Q20, and Q100, the proposed treatment, and sample cross sections are presented. The thesis concludes with an assessment of the effect of the modification on the existing flood condition.

The Applicability of the JONSWAP Spectrum for Wave Events at Small Water Surfaces
Gřegoř, Adam
Task of the research was to determine whether the spectral density (i.e. spectrum) of wind wave events at Hulínská štěrkovna reservoir is the same as the JONSWAP spectrum, which was based at the wave events at partially developed sea. Data about the time course of the water surface elevation at reservoir were processed with use of the MATLAB and WAFO toolbox that was developed by the Lund University.
